Top 5 Solutions for Data Protection

September 27, 2019

There is a large number of historic hacks that have come into light in recent years. It seems like every month brings with it a new headline of some epic hack. With your personal identity and the credibility of your business at stake, data security has never been more important.

How do you keep your data secure? There is no single, simple, straightforward solution to this question, but there are a number of steps that can be taken. Here are five solutions for data protection.

1. Use Strong and Unique Passwords

The password is widely considered to be the weakest link in the cybersecurity chain. The vast majority of data breaches come in the form of an attacker gaining access to login credentials through a number of different means.

One of the most basic ways to safeguard against this attack vector is to use passwords that aren’t easily guessed or cracked and to use different passwords for different accounts.

Passwords should be 14 characters long, and if you can remember it, it’s not that secure. Using unique passwords is important because if an attacker gains access to one password, and you have used the same password elsewhere, now multiple accounts will be compromised.

2. Set Up Two-Factor Authentication

Two-factor authentication (2FA) is simple to set up and provides an extra layer of protection from fraudulent login attempts. There are several different methods of 2FA. The most common and least secure is via SMS text verification code. This has been proven ineffective as attackers can intercept the code en route to your phone.

More secure methods involve authenticator apps and hardware security keys that generate unique codes locally on a device. Use these methods wherever possible.

3. Use Firewalls

Firewalls should be installed on both the network and device level. This means that your wireless router should have security methods like a firewall in place as well as every computer on that network. This makes it more difficult for attacks that use the vector of gaining access to your wireless network to compromise your data.

When configuring a firewall, be sure to block not only all incoming connections but all outgoing connections that you do not need. Malware has to communicate outside your network to be effective, so blocking outbound connections for unnecessary apps provides an extra layer of security.

4. Know How to Spot Phishing Attempts

Most hacks don’t occur because of some super-sophisticated hacking method. They happen because someone fell victim to a phishing attack or failed to install routine software updates.

Every individual who uses a computer should know how to spot a phishing attack. Most often, these come in the form of an email containing a fake website link or a file download.

The email might look like it’s coming from a trusted source. However, when you download the file, you’re infected with malware, or when you click the link, you enter your credentials into a fake website.

5. Use Secure Backup Solutions

One of the simplest and easiest data protection solutions involves routine backups of all your data. There are a number of ways to do this.

The most common ways to backup your data involve an external hard drive and cloud storage. Many people save files to cloud solutions like Dropbox, Google Drive, Microsoft One Drive, or iCloud. This, in addition to setting up automatic backups to a backup drive, goes a long way.

In the end, implementing these solutions for data protection will serve you well. Keep these five things in mind, whether you’re an organization or individual.
